State Machines is a programme of activities devoted to the investigation of new relationships between states, citizens and the stateless made possible by emerging technologies. Focussing on how such technologies impact identity and citizenship, digital labour and finance, the project joins five experienced partners Aksioma(Slovenia), Drugo more (Croatia), Furtherfield (UK), Institute of Network Cultures (Netherlands) and NeMe (Cyprus) together with a range of artists, curators, theorists and audiences.
How might the digital subjects of today become active, engaged, and effective digital citizens of tomorrow.
State Machines will support the production of the selected proposal with 5.000 € towards fees and production costs, will assist in all phases of production process and the final project will be exhibited in at least two offline and one online exhibition during 2018/19
Deadline 31 January 2018
